About Michel Hilsum
Michel Hilsum is a scholar working on Algebra and Number Theory, Mathematical Physics and Geometry and Topology, having authored 9 papers that have together received 204 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Advanced Operator Algebra Research (6 papers), Advanced Topics in Algebra (4 papers) and Holomorphic and Operator Theory (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Algebra and Number Theory (128 citations), Mathematical Physics (197 citations) and Geometry and Topology (78 citations). Michel Hilsum has collaborated with scholars based in France. Frequent co-authors include Georges Skandalis. Their work appears in journals such as Annals of Mathematics, Journal of Functional Analysis and Journal of Differential Geometry.
